Polymer Resources PPX-FR1 Modified-PPO, V-0 Flame Retardant
Categories: Polymer; Thermoplastic; Polyphenylene Ether/PPO; Polyphenylene Ether, Heat Resistant

Material Notes: Modified-Polyphenylene Oxide, V-0 Flame Retardant, 190F HDT

Features: • Bromine Free • Chlorine Free
Process: Injection Molding
Notes: All physical, mechanical and thermal testing conducted on 1/8-inch thick, un-pigmented, test samples.

Information provided by Polymer Resources Corporation.

Key Words: UL E113219; Polyphenylene Ether + PS

Physical PropertiesMetricEnglishComments
Specific Gravity 1.08 g/cc1.08 g/ccASTM D792
Linear Mold Shrinkage 0.0050 - 0.0070 cm/cm0.0050 - 0.0070 in/inASTM D955
Melt Flow 25 - 50 g/10 min
@Load 11.6 kg,
Temperature 250 °C
25 - 50 g/10 min
@Load 25.6 lb,
Temperature 482 °F
ASTM D1238
 
Mechanical PropertiesMetricEnglishComments
Hardness, Rockwell R 118118ASTM D785
Tensile Strength at Break 41.4 MPa6000 psiASTM D638
Tensile Strength, Yield 44.8 MPa6500 psiASTM D638
Elongation at Break 9.0 %9.0 %ASTM D638
Elongation at Yield 3.5 %3.5 %ASTM D638
Tensile Modulus 2.41 GPa350 ksiASTM D638
Flexural Strength 89.6 MPa13000 psiASTM D790
Flexural Modulus 2.07 GPa300 ksiASTM D790

Processing PropertiesMetricEnglishComments
Rear Barrel Temperature 216 - 266 °C420 - 510 °F
Middle Barrel Temperature 227 - 271 °C440 - 520 °F
Front Barrel Temperature 238 - 277 °C460 - 530 °F
Melt Temperature 246 - 274 °C475 - 525 °F
Mold Temperature 54.4 - 76.7 °C130 - 170 °F
Drying Temperature 71.1 - 82.2 °C160 - 180 °F
Dry Time 3.00 - 4.00 hour3.00 - 4.00 hour
Vent Depth 0.00254 cm0.00100 in
